| Umholi-mw | incazelo |
| Cha. | Ipharamitha | Okuncane kakhulu | Okuvamile | Ubuningi | Amayunithi |
| 1 | Ibanga lokuvama | 0.1 | - | 22 | I-GHz |
| 2 | Inzuzo | 27 | 30 | dB | |
| 4 | Thola Ukuthamba | ±2.0 |
| db | |
| 5 | Isithombe Somsindo | - | 3.0 | 4.5 | dB |
| 6 | Amandla Okukhipha e-P1dB | 23 | 25 | i-dBM | |
| 7 | Amandla Okukhipha i-Psat | 24 | 26 | i-dBM | |
| 8 | I-VSWR | 2.5 | 2.0 | - | |
| 9 | I-Voltage Yokunikezela | +5 | V | ||
| 10 | I-DC yamanje | 600 | mA | ||
| 11 | Amandla Okufaka Aphezulu | -5 | i-dBm | ||
| 12 | Isixhumi | I-SMA-F | |||
| 13 | Okungamanga | -60 | i-dBc | ||
| 14 | Ukuphazamiseka | 50 | Ω | ||
| 15 | Izinga Lokushisa Lokusebenza | -30℃~ +55℃ | |||
| 16 | Isisindo | 50G | |||
| 15 | Umbala wokuqeda okhethwayo | i-sliver | |||

| Umholi-mw | Imininingwane Yezemvelo |
| Izinga Lokushisa Lokusebenza | -30ºC~+55ºC |
| Izinga Lokushisa Lesitoreji | -50ºC~+85ºC |
| Ukudlidliza | Ukuqina okungu-25gRMS (15 degrees 2KHz), ihora eli-1 nge-axis ngayinye |
| Umswakama | 100% RH ku-35ºc, 95%RH ku-40ºc |
| Ukushaqeka | 20G ye-11msec half sine wave, ama-axis ama-3 kuzo zombili izinkomba |
| Umholi-mw | Imininingwane Yemishini |
| Izindlu | I-Aluminium |
| Isixhumi | Insimbi engagqwali |
| Oxhumana Nabo Owesifazane: | igolide elimbozwe ngethusi le-beryllium |
| AmaRoh | ukuthobela imithetho |
| Isisindo | 0.1kg |
